The Puppy Rules



Two guiding rules exists for helping puppies and puppy owners in puppy training. Make sure to never punish your dog for something you didn't see him do. And 2nd, praise your dog for your things he did do right. Do not train by only using "no" when you see your puppy doing something it should not be doing. Desirable behavior needs to be met with praise and treats.



Housebreaking/House Training your pup



There are various processes to house train your pup. When starting indoors, encourage a puppy to use puppy training pads or papers to go to the bathroom on. Puppy pads generally are treated with scented chemicals that lure pups and obtain these phones make use of the pads. The minute you notice them beginning the pre-elimination routine of pacing and sniffing at the floor, lift in the puppy and quietly relocate them to the paper or puppy training pads, then offer them an incentive for appropriately going to the bathroom.



Once the new dog is comfortable using the papers or puppy training pads, they could then be placed close to the door or even outside. The transition is accomplished by focusing their toilet habits in a specific in your home to an outside place. Inside the very near future you should have no requirement for papers or training pads indoors.



The largest issue with this technique of puppy potty training is always that is requires more time to find the puppy to go indoors. When potty training puppies, other popular techniques might work; you can, for example, use puppy crate training or cages, always accompanied by the owner's close supervision.



When utilizing a cage or crate to housebreak your dog, realize that puppies can't choose more than about seven to eight hours without needing the restroom. Crate training usually works because dogs do not like to mess their sleeping places, then have to lie inside it. Leaving them within their cage or crate for days on end, however, is not good to complete.



This is not to express, though, that continual supervision involves crates or cages, and paper or puppy pads. It's here that puppy owners opt to spend whatever time is necessary using their pups. This works good for those people who are retired, work from home, or any owner that can spend time and effort with all the puppy. Canine owners can usually usher their dog outside once the pre-potty signs are located with this particular technique. A consistent watch has to be continued puppies to ensure that there aren't any accidents or slip-ups.
